About the Role

We are recruiting on behalf of a well-established and growing Northern Ireland-based company with a strong reputation in the renewable energy sector. Due to continued growth and increasing demand for solar installations, they are seeking a qualified Electrician to join their expanding team. This role involves working across Northern Ireland on both solar installations. While solar experience is desirable, it is not essential; training and support will be provided for the right candidate.

Key Responsibilities

  • Install, maintain, and commission solar PV systems across domestic and commercial properties
  • Carry out inspection, testing, and certification of electrical installations
  • Ensure all work complies with 18th Edition wiring regulations
  • Diagnose faults and carry out repairs efficiently
  • Maintain high standards of safety and workmanship at all times
  • Work independently and as part of a team to deliver projects on time

Essential Criteria

  • NVQ Level 3 (or equivalent) in Electrical Installation
  • 18th Edition Wiring Regulations
  • Inspection & Testing qualification
  • Full UK driving licence
  • Strong attention to detail and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to work both independently and within a team

Desirable

  • Previous experience in solar PV installations (not essential)

What's on Offer

  • Competitive salary of £40,000 - £45,000 (DOE)
  • Company van provided
  • Monday to Friday working schedule
  • Opportunity to join a growing renewable energy company
  • Career progression as the business continues to expand
